Effective communication between adults and children?

One big difference would be that children are not little adults so when you are explaining things to them or just talking to them you need to use words they can understand, you need to avoid language and topics they shouldn't hear and you should get on their level when speaking to them when ever possible rather than constantly talking down to them. Don't assume just because you think something is obvious that the child will also find it obvious as well.


Explain how age can be a communication barrier?

Terminology between children, adolescence and adult varies quite a lot. Age could be seen as a barrier because things 2 teengaers would say to one another wouldnt be easy to understand in the view of an adult or a child; Mostly due to 'slang'. Also its the same with adults as 2 adults could talk about real life scenarios and things that happen and children and teenagers would be very confused.

How do you adapt communication to meet different communication needs of adults?

You need to have multiple ways to communicate for adults. Some may need sign language. Some may need communication in a foreign language. Some may need audio rather than written communication.
